{"id":22721,"count":1,"description":"Wallins Creek is a city in Harlan County, Kentucky, United States. The population was 257 at the 2000 census and was estimated at 235 in 2007.\nWallins Creek began life as a coalmining town in 1925; the mine was owned by the Wallins Creek Coal Corporation. The Wallins Creek Baptist church was established in 1855 with 30 members.\nWallins Creek is said to be haunted by an old coal miner who died in an explosion and who walks alongside the roadside to his former home.\nWallins Creek is located at 36\u00b049\u203241\u2033N 83\u00b024\u203252\u2033W\ufeff \/ \ufeff36.82806\u00b0N 83.41444\u00b0W\ufeff \/ 36.82806; -83.41444 (36.828036, -83.414449).\nAccording to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 0.4 square miles (1.0\u00a0km), all of it land.\nAs of the census of 2000, there were 257 people, 112 households, and 73 families residing in the city. The population density was 657.8 people per square mile (254.4\/km\u00b2). There were 126 housing units at an average density of 322.5 per square mile (124.7\/km\u00b2).
